/external/libnl/include/ |
D | netlink-tc.h | 32 extern int tca_parse(struct nlattr **, int, struct rtnl_tca *, 34 extern int tca_msg_parser(struct nlmsghdr *, struct rtnl_tca *); 35 extern void tca_free_data(struct rtnl_tca *); 36 extern int tca_clone(struct rtnl_tca *, struct rtnl_tca *); 37 extern void tca_dump_line(struct rtnl_tca *, const char *, 39 extern void tca_dump_details(struct rtnl_tca *, struct nl_dump_params *); 40 extern void tca_dump_stats(struct rtnl_tca *, struct nl_dump_params *); 43 extern void tca_set_ifindex(struct rtnl_tca *, int); 44 extern int tca_get_ifindex(struct rtnl_tca *); 45 extern void tca_set_handle(struct rtnl_tca *, uint32_t); [all …]
|
D | netlink-types.h | 460 struct rtnl_tca struct
|
/external/libnl/lib/route/sch/ |
D | cbq.c | 76 static inline struct rtnl_cbq *cbq_qdisc(struct rtnl_tca *tca) in cbq_qdisc() 81 static inline struct rtnl_cbq *cbq_alloc(struct rtnl_tca *tca) in cbq_alloc() 90 static int cbq_msg_parser(struct rtnl_tca *tca) in cbq_msg_parser() 118 return cbq_msg_parser((struct rtnl_tca *) qdisc); in cbq_qdisc_msg_parser() 123 return cbq_msg_parser((struct rtnl_tca *) class); in cbq_class_msg_parser() 131 static int cbq_clone(struct rtnl_tca *_dst, struct rtnl_tca *_src) in cbq_clone() 143 return cbq_clone((struct rtnl_tca *) dst, (struct rtnl_tca *) src); in cbq_qdisc_clone() 153 return cbq_clone((struct rtnl_tca *) dst, (struct rtnl_tca *) src); in cbq_class_clone() 156 static void cbq_dump_line(struct rtnl_tca *tca, struct nl_dump_params *p) in cbq_dump_line() 176 cbq_dump_line((struct rtnl_tca *) qdisc, p); in cbq_qdisc_dump_line() [all …]
|
D | dsmark.c | 66 err = tca_parse(tb, TCA_DSMARK_MAX, (struct rtnl_tca *) qdisc, in dsmark_qdisc_msg_parser() 114 err = tca_parse(tb, TCA_DSMARK_MAX, (struct rtnl_tca *) class, in dsmark_class_msg_parser()
|
D | red.c | 64 err = tca_parse(tb, TCA_RED_MAX, (struct rtnl_tca *) qdisc, red_policy); in red_msg_parser()
|
D | htb.c | 68 err = tca_parse(tb, TCA_HTB_MAX, (struct rtnl_tca *) qdisc, htb_policy); in htb_qdisc_msg_parser() 106 err = tca_parse(tb, TCA_HTB_MAX, (struct rtnl_tca *) class, htb_policy); in htb_class_msg_parser()
|
D | tbf.c | 61 err = tca_parse(tb, TCA_TBF_MAX, (struct rtnl_tca *) q, tbf_policy); in tbf_msg_parser()
|
/external/libnl/lib/route/ |
D | qdisc_obj.c | 34 tca_free_data((struct rtnl_tca *) qdisc); in qdisc_free_data() 48 err = tca_clone((struct rtnl_tca *) dst, (struct rtnl_tca *) src); in qdisc_clone() 64 tca_dump_line((struct rtnl_tca *) qdisc, "qdisc", p); in qdisc_dump_line() 80 tca_dump_details((struct rtnl_tca *) qdisc, p); in qdisc_dump_details() 96 tca_dump_stats((struct rtnl_tca *) qdisc, p); in qdisc_dump_stats() 185 tca_set_ifindex((struct rtnl_tca *) qdisc, ifindex); in rtnl_qdisc_set_ifindex() 190 return tca_get_ifindex((struct rtnl_tca *) qdisc); in rtnl_qdisc_get_ifindex() 195 tca_set_handle((struct rtnl_tca *) qdisc, handle); in rtnl_qdisc_set_handle() 200 return tca_get_handle((struct rtnl_tca *) qdisc); in rtnl_qdisc_get_handle() 205 tca_set_parent((struct rtnl_tca *) qdisc, parent); in rtnl_qdisc_set_parent() [all …]
|
D | class_obj.c | 33 tca_free_data((struct rtnl_tca *) class); in class_free_data() 47 err = tca_clone((struct rtnl_tca *) dst, (struct rtnl_tca *) src); in class_clone() 63 tca_dump_line((struct rtnl_tca *) class, "class", p); in class_dump_line() 77 tca_dump_details((struct rtnl_tca *) class, p); in class_dump_details() 100 tca_dump_stats((struct rtnl_tca *) class, p); in class_dump_stats() 220 tca_set_ifindex((struct rtnl_tca *) class, ifindex); in rtnl_class_set_ifindex() 225 return tca_get_ifindex((struct rtnl_tca *) class); in rtnl_class_get_ifindex() 230 tca_set_handle((struct rtnl_tca *) class, handle); in rtnl_class_set_handle() 235 return tca_get_handle((struct rtnl_tca *) class); in rtnl_class_get_handle() 240 tca_set_parent((struct rtnl_tca *) class, parent); in rtnl_class_set_parent() [all …]
|
D | tc.c | 36 int tca_parse(struct nlattr **tb, int maxattr, struct rtnl_tca *g, in tca_parse() 58 int tca_msg_parser(struct nlmsghdr *n, struct rtnl_tca *g) in tca_msg_parser() 163 void tca_free_data(struct rtnl_tca *tca) in tca_free_data() 169 int tca_clone(struct rtnl_tca *dst, struct rtnl_tca *src) in tca_clone() 186 void tca_dump_line(struct rtnl_tca *g, const char *type, in tca_dump_line() 209 void tca_dump_details(struct rtnl_tca *g, struct nl_dump_params *p) in tca_dump_details() 214 void tca_dump_stats(struct rtnl_tca *g, struct nl_dump_params *p) in tca_dump_stats() 248 struct rtnl_tca *a = (struct rtnl_tca *) _a; in tca_compare() 249 struct rtnl_tca *b = (struct rtnl_tca *) _b; in tca_compare() 264 void tca_set_ifindex(struct rtnl_tca *t, int ifindex) in tca_set_ifindex() [all …]
|
D | cls_obj.c | 37 tca_free_data((struct rtnl_tca *) cls); in cls_free_data() 53 err = tca_clone((struct rtnl_tca *) dst, (struct rtnl_tca *) src); in cls_clone() 77 tca_dump_line((struct rtnl_tca *) cls, "cls", p); in cls_dump_line() 94 tca_dump_details((struct rtnl_tca *) cls, p); in cls_dump_details() 109 tca_dump_stats((struct rtnl_tca *) cls, p); in cls_dump_stats() 142 tca_set_ifindex((struct rtnl_tca *) f, ifindex); in rtnl_cls_set_ifindex() 152 tca_set_handle((struct rtnl_tca *) f, handle); in rtnl_cls_set_handle() 157 tca_set_parent((struct rtnl_tca *) f, parent); in rtnl_cls_set_parent() 170 tca_set_kind((struct rtnl_tca *) cls, kind); in rtnl_cls_set_kind()
|
D | class.c | 44 err = tca_msg_parser(n, (struct rtnl_tca *) class); in class_msg_parser() 84 err = tca_build_msg((struct rtnl_tca *) class, type, flags, result); in class_build()
|
D | cls.c | 52 err = tca_msg_parser(nlh, (struct rtnl_tca *) cls); in cls_msg_parser() 90 err = tca_build_msg((struct rtnl_tca *) cls, type, flags, result); in cls_build()
|
D | qdisc.c | 113 err = tca_msg_parser(n, (struct rtnl_tca *) qdisc); in qdisc_msg_parser() 153 err = tca_build_msg((struct rtnl_tca *) qdisc, type, flags, result); in qdisc_build()
|
/external/libnl/lib/route/cls/ |
D | cgroup.c | 50 err = tca_parse(tb, TCA_CGROUP_MAX, (struct rtnl_tca *) cls, in cgroup_msg_parser()
|
D | fw.c | 47 err = tca_parse(tb, TCA_FW_MAX, (struct rtnl_tca *) cls, fw_policy); in fw_msg_parser()
|
D | basic.c | 70 err = tca_parse(tb, TCA_BASIC_MAX, (struct rtnl_tca *) cls, basic_policy); in basic_msg_parser()
|
D | u32.c | 73 err = tca_parse(tb, TCA_U32_MAX, (struct rtnl_tca *) cls, u32_policy); in u32_msg_parser() 348 tca_set_handle((struct rtnl_tca *) cls, handle ); in rtnl_u32_set_handle()
|